What is the HMPV Virus? Why is it affecting children?

Human Metapneumovirus (HMPV) is a respiratory virus that generally causes mild to moderate flu-like symptoms. The virus is most prevalent during the winter and early spring months. It is primarily transmitted through direct contact with infected individuals or contaminated surfaces.

What are the HMPV Virus Symptoms?

The common symptoms include cough, fever, sore throat, runny or stuffy nose, and, in some cases, wheezing or shortness of breath.

Some people, especially children, the elderly, or those with fatigued immune systems, may experience more harsh respiratory conditions such as pneumonia or bronchiolitis.
